- What is the primary objective of Viridien's seismic reimaging program in Walker Ridge?
- The program aims to deliver enhanced, high-resolution subsurface imagery beneath thick, complex salt canopies in the Walker Ridge area. This helps offshore operators better delineate deep exploration prospects and reduce drilling risks near existing infrastructure.
- Why are deepwater operators focusing on infrastructure-led exploration (ILX)?
- Infrastructure-led exploration allows companies to target satellite prospects that can be tied back directly to operational hubs, significantly shortening development timelines and reducing capital expenditure. This strategy delivers lower break-even costs, faster returns on investment, and lower carbon intensity compared to developing standalone greenfield facilities.
- How does seismic reimaging differ from acquiring new seismic data?
- Seismic reimaging applies modern computational algorithms and advanced processing techniques, such as Full-Waveform Inversion (FWI), to existing legacy seismic datasets. This approach provides significantly clearer geological models in a fraction of the time and at a substantially lower cost compared to deploying offshore survey vessels to record new field data.
